Anna Kazanjian Longobardo SEAS '49, '52, was a trustee emerita of the university. She was the first woman to ever complete a four-year undergraduate degree in SEAS. She was the Director of Strategic Initiatives for Unisys before she retired. She was a recipient of numerous awards, including the Egleston Medal. She served as a president emerita of the Columbia Engineering Alumni Association.
